Toyota 2000 GT

The Toyota 2000 GT, one of the first sports cars ever built, was developed in collaboration with Nissan. The two companies entered into a technology sharing agreement in September 1965. The design team consisted of Toyota engineers Shinichi Yamazaki and Hidemasa Takagi, test driver Eizo Matsuda, and design assistant/development driver Shihomi Hosoya. Shoichi Saito, a Toyota industrial designer, was responsible for the project. Toyota industrial designer Satoru Nazaki designed the car's shape. He used a full-size wooden Buck as an inspiration.

Statistics

  • According to the BLS, the median annual salary for automotive service technicians and mechanics in the United States was $44,050 in May 2020. (uti.edu)
  • According to the BLS, total auto technician employment is expected to exceed 705,000 by 2030. (uti.edu)
  • Apprentice mechanics earn significantly less hourly than mechanics who have completed training, with a median wage of approximately $14.50 an hour, according to PayScale. (jobhero.com)
